A viral video captured former Rep. Matt Gaetz exchanging texts with his mother aboard a flight, sparking attention for both his political strategy and personal finances. In the 72-second clip, Gaetz solicited advice about engaging with former President Trump, prompting his mother to warn him against criticizing MAGA followers or jeopardizing his media role.
She cautioned: “The president has been a very good friend to you… MAGA will turn on you,” urging him to stay loyal to maintain his audience. Gaetz responded that he aims to “guide” Trump rather than rebuke him, asserting he manages the balance between public commentary and private influence.
Their discussion then shifted to Gaetz’s wealth—he disclosed owning two penthouse condos, maintaining a 1:1 real estate asset-to-debt ratio, and having $500,000 in cash. He also shared a long-held concern that Iran has been “three months away from a nuke since 1992.”
After the video gained traction, Gaetz posted on X, acknowledging the recording and teasing improving his eyesight with a screen protector. He encouraged followers to “CALL YOUR MOTHER!” He remains a host on One America News following his withdrawal from a Trump-era attorney general nomination and resignation from Congress.
